Kigoma is a small town surrounded by rugged mountains and forests in a tropical setting overlooking Lake Tanganyika on the eastern side. In 1915, Kigoma became the main trading base in the region and to date it is the main port on Lake Tanganyika and the main railway stop in the west of Tanzania. Its former importance, the final stop of the central line Railway, can still be found in the stately railway station, Kaiser House, the seat of government, and other German government buildings and houses.
One of the highlights of a visit to Kigoma is the steamer Liemba, originally built in Germany in 1913 and considered the oldest operational passenger vessel in the world. It makes a good overland base for visits and chimpanzee safaris to both Gombe Stream National Park and Mahale National Park.
